struttura TS_STATUS (textstor.h)

La struttura TS_STATUS contiene i dati sullo stato del documento.

Sintassi

typedef struct TS_STATUS {
  DWORD dwDynamicFlags;
  DWORD dwStaticFlags;
} TS_STATUS;

Members

dwDynamicFlags

Contiene un set di flag che possono essere modificati da un'app in fase di esecuzione. Ad esempio, un'app può abilitare una casella di controllo per l'utente per reimpostare lo stato del documento. Questo membro può contenere zero o uno o più dei valori seguenti.

valore Significato
TS_SD_LOADING È in corso il caricamento del documento.
TS_SD_READONLY Il documento è di sola lettura.

dwStaticFlags

Contiene un set di flag che non possono essere modificati in fase di esecuzione. Questo membro può contenere zero o uno o più dei valori seguenti.

valore Significato
TS_SS_DISJOINTSEL Il documento supporta più selezioni.
TS_SS_REGIONS Il documento può contenere più aree.
TS_SS_TRANSITORY Si prevede che il documento abbia un breve ciclo di utilizzo.
TS_SS_NOHIDDENTEXT Il documento non conterrà mai testo nascosto.
TS_SS_TKBAUTOCORRECTENABLE A partire da Windows 8: Il documento supporta la correzione automatica fornita dalla tastiera virtuale.
TS_SS_TKBPREDICTIONENABLE A partire da Windows 8: Il documento supporta i suggerimenti di testo forniti dalla tastiera virtuale.

Commenti

La struttura TF_STATUS contiene dati sullo stato del documento.

TF_STATUS è un alias per TS_STATUS.

dwDynamicFlags contiene un set di flag che possono essere modificati da un'app in fase di esecuzione. Ad esempio, un'app può abilitare una casella di controllo per l'utente per reimpostare lo stato della documentazione. Questo membro può contenere zero o uno o più dei valori seguenti.

valore Significato
TF_SD_LOADING È in corso il caricamento del documento.
TF_SD_READONLY Il documento è di sola lettura.
TS_SD_UIINTEGRATIONENABLE A partire da Windows 8.1: il controllo di testo proprietario del documento imposta questo flag per indicare il supporto dell'integrazione dell'interfaccia utente di Input Method Editor (IME). Se specificato, l'IME deve tentare di allineare la finestra candidata sotto la casella di testo anziché mobile vicino al cursore.
Nota Non tutti gli IMEs rispondono a questo flag. Gli elenchi candidati IME sono posizionati sullo schermo con dimensioni sufficienti per consentire l'input di testo di base. In alcuni casi, l'IME può applicare una dimensione minima ragionevole. Un IME può anche scegliere di modificare la finestra candidata e il comportamento di input della tastiera per offrire un'esperienza utente migliore, ad esempio l'uso di un elenco candidato orizzontale e consentendo l'invio di alcuni tasti come freccia su e freccia giù all'app per scenari come lo spostamento dell'elenco di suggerimenti.
 
TF_SD_TKBAUTOCORRECTENABLE A partire da Windows 8.1: il documento supporta la correzione automatica fornita dalla tastiera virtuale. Questo supporto può cambiare durante la durata del controllo.
TF_SD_TKBPREDICTIONENABLE A partire da Windows 8.1: il documento supporta i suggerimenti di testo forniti dalla tastiera virtuale. Questo supporto può cambiare durante la durata del controllo.
 

dwStaticFlags contiene un set di flag che non possono essere modificati in fase di esecuzione. Questo membro può contenere zero o uno o più dei valori seguenti.

valore Significato
TF_SS_DISJOINTSEL Il documento supporta più selezioni.
TF_SS_REGIONS Il documento può contenere più aree.
TF_SS_TRANSITORY Si prevede che il documento abbia un breve ciclo di utilizzo.
TF_SS_TKBAUTOCORRECTENABLE A partire da Windows 8: Il documento supporta la correzione automatica fornita dalla tastiera virtuale.
TF_SS_TKBPREDICTIONENABLE A partire da Windows 8: Il documento supporta i suggerimenti di testo forniti dalla tastiera virtuale.

Requisiti

   
Client minimo supportato Windows 2000 Professional [solo app desktop]
Server minimo supportato Windows 2000 Server [solo app desktop]
Intestazione textstor.h
Componente ridistribuibile TSF 1.0 in Windows 2000 Professional

Vedi anche

ITextStoreACP::GetStatus

ITextStoreACPSink::OnStatusChange

ITextStoreAnchor::GetStatus

ITextStoreAnchorSink::OnStatusChange